Output 427510e81c3aaefbce794263b05271765fee95f112a07cd774706f2b59c1f507:22

value
107031542
script pubkey
OP_0 OP_PUSHBYTES_32 ceff93a4a1d33f1df57f6164b1adbf4748adb797de8cf6f4f8b3c3a602c41dd2
address
bc1qemle8f9p6vl3matlv9jtrtdlgay2mduhm6x0da8ck0p6vqkyrhfqvm0u66
transaction
427510e81c3aaefbce794263b05271765fee95f112a07cd774706f2b59c1f507
spent
true